Dictionary of Nature Myths: Legends the Earth, Sea, and Sky
Pages: 300, Paperback, Oxford University Press, U.S.A.
Price History
Prices were last updated on:
Pages: 300, Paperback, Oxford University Press, U.S.A.
Prices were last updated on: